A TAXI driver who was held up by a gang armed with a baseball bat has today spoken of his terrifying ordeal.

The 59-year-old, who does not wish to be named, said he has been unable to sleep and has been left badly shaken by the robbery.

The Ipswich man was answering a call for cab company Four One Seven when a trio of hooded men got into the back of the car and threatened him with a baseball bat.

He said: “I heard them say 'let's do it' and then I had baseball bat at my throat.

“One of them said 'give me the money' but I said I don't have any because I had just started my shift.

“Somehow they got across to my pouch of change and got out. I got out and one of them swung the bat and smashed the rear window.”

During the ordeal the man managed to press a button in his cab to alert the company and police arrived on scene soon after.

They are now investigating the incident and have taken the man's Vauxhall Vectra from the scene in Badash Avenue so forensic examinations can be conducted.

He has also given a statement to police and identified his possible attackers using police photographs.

He added: “I feel like crying at the moment. I have been a taxi driver for four years and I have never had any trouble.

“I want these people done. I want that one with the baseball bat done. He could have had a knife or a gun and if you carry a weapon, you will use it.”

The driver believes the men had called him to Badash Avenue at about 9.45pm on Sunday with the intention of carrying out the robbery.

He thinks they had called the company to Nansen Road prior to the incident but had then not turned up, calling again later with a the Badash Avenue address.

Eric Pearl of the Ipswich Taxi Driver Association said the incident was the first of its kind in the town.

He said: “We have been fearing robberies like this and this the first of that sort - it is pretty scary.

“The police have just given us a safety leaflet on how to look after ourselves but if you have a person determined to rob you then it is going to happen, you have just got to limit the dangers.”

The first robber is described as of mixed race, 20-25, 5ft 5in tall and of chubby build.

He wore a dark hooded top with the hood up. The others both wore hoods and were of a smaller build.
